The barometric pressure in Lebanon, Oregon varies throughout the year. It changes depending on the time of day and the weather patterns. Low pressure systems bring rainy and overcast weather. High pressure systems bring clear and sunny skies.
Lebanon is situated in the Willamette Valley. The valley is surrounded by mountains to the east and west. The Coast Range is to the west and the Cascades are to the east. These mountain ranges affect the air flow and pressure. They block or redirect air masses that move into the valley.
The surrounding landscape also creates a rain shadow effect. The air is forced to rise, cool, and condense, resulting in precipitation. This is why the climate is wetter than other parts of Oregon. Lebanon's weather is influenced by its location in the valley.
